Chapter Nineteen

They barely spoke as Dennis drove them back into town, and once back, they decided to stop for lunch. When they were settled at their table, waiting to be served, Norman voiced his thoughts. 'Here's the thing. According to Bradshaw, the Shapiro brothers have a huge drug operation, right?'

'Yes, except Jerry seems to think he's no longer part of it.'

'Whether he's still part of it is neither here nor there, so ignore that for a minute. My point is, whoever runs a drug operation that big must have a small army of people on the ground, and enough money to buy just about any information they want. And yet Jerry says they couldn't identify the guy who tried to abduct Jenny, or the competitor they thought might be trying to muscle in on their territory. Does that sound likely to you?'

'Yeah, I see what you mean,' Darling said thoughtfully. 'D'you think he was lying?'

'Isn't it good business to know who your competitors are and what they're up to? It must be even more important when it comes to heavy stuff like drug dealing. You don't stay on top in that world without knowing who's who and what's what.'

'But if they knew who it was, they would have done something about it, wouldn't they?'

'Well, yeah, you would think so,' Norman said. 'But maybe we're looking at it the wrong way. What if Jerry's telling the truth, and as far as he knows, they didn't find out who was responsible?'

'I don't want to appear thick,' Darling said, screwing her face up, 'but I think you might be in danger of losing me here.'

'Well, think about what we know,' said Norman. 'Jerry says Ben didn't have a problem with him having a relationship with Jenny. Consider that for a minute. Two brothers have been partners in a huge illegal business for a few years, making shedloads of money, and now one of them has decided to bring a girlfriend into their world. If you were Ben, would you be happy about that?'

'They are brothers,' Darling reminded him.

'Yeah, but don't forget – the girlfriend in question just happens to be a woman who's spent half her life working in the legal establishment. Bradshaw mentioned a possible feud, and we know Ben's not exactly the warm, cosy, user-friendly sort of drug dealer, is he?'

Darling's eyes widened. 'You think Ben sent threats to his own brother's girlfriend?'

'Is it so unthinkable? Remember what I said earlier – these people have different morals. What if Ben didn't trust Jenny? Okay, she might have saved his arse from a prison sentence, but that doesn't mean he's happy for her to come along and be part of the family business. He must have been aware of the outcry when Jenny won their case, but maybe he doesn't buy this idea she's been forced to quit the legal profession. What if he thought she could be part of an elaborate plan to finally put them behind bars?'

'So there never was a competitor trying to move in?'

Norman shook his head.
